AUSTIN, TX / ACCESSWIRE / December 17, 2015 / Yesterday Green Party of Texas announced its nomination and submission of candidate paperwork to elections office for Vanessa S. Tijerina as the party's official candidate for 2016 U.S. Representative seat at Texas' 15th congressional district, which is currently held by Congressman Rubén Hinojosa (D), who is confirmed to not be running for re-election after serving as a U.S. Representative since 1997.
Tijerina (37), a Hispanic-American who is a native of Raymondville, Texas working as a registered nurse since 1999, and has spent the past decade volunteering for minority, veteran, and women rights activities in Texas with the anticipation to bring awareness to medicinal marijuana, immigration laws, domestic violence, education, human trafficking, and job creation for minorities and military families in Texas. Her past works as a public servant and political activist have been mentioned in the local news. Her more recent interaction with Capitol Hill has placed her into delegations as an observer at a recent White House cyber-conference in efforts to combat discrimination against world religions.
On Monday afternoon congressional lobbyist and election campaign guru Cary Peterson of Robert Peterson and Fields Associates confirmed that his firm was representing 'Tijerina for Greener Texas' campaign committee, which was filed at Federal Elections Commission in Washington, D.C. this morning. Peterson comments that 'her participation in the 2016 congressional election was much needed and will be a game changer for the State of Texas; nonetheless he's excited to see how the campaign progresses.'
